Gottfried Wilhelm Leibniz
The term "function" was
literally introduced
by Gottfried Leibniz, in
a 1673 letter, to describe
a quantity related to
points of a curve, such as
a coordinate or curve's
slope.

Linear Functions
A function f is a linear function if f(x) = mx +
b, where m and b are real numbers, and m and
f(x) are not both equal to zero.

y = 2x + 3
f(x) = -4x + 3

Constant and Identity Function
Constant function - f(x) = b

Identity function - f(x) = x

PIECEWISE FUNCTION
- is a function defined by multiple sub-
functions, where each sub-functions
applies to a certain interval of the main
function’s domain.

Sample Problem
You are a crew at PCS Convenience Store that pays an hourly wage of 45 pesos and
1.5 times the hourly wage for the extra hours if you work more than 40 hours a week.
a. Write a piecewise function that gives the weekly pay P in terms of the number of
hours h you work.
b. Graph the piecewise function.
Solutions:
c. For up to 40 hours, your pay is given by P = 45h.
For over 40 hours, your pay is given by:
45(40) + 1.5(45)(h – 40)
Thus, the piecewise function is:

A videoke machine can be rented for 1000 pesos for three days, but for the fourth
day onwards, an additional cost of 400 pesos per day is added. Represent the cost of
renting a videoke machine as a piecewise function of the number of days it is rented
and plot its graph.

Solution: for 3 days of renting = 1000 pesos


for over 3 days of rent the payment is given by:
1000 + 400 (x – 3)

Thus, the piecewise function is:

1000 if 0 3
P(h) = 1000+ 400(x – 3), if x > 3
